This rising expertise harnesses small molecules to induce extremely particular elimination of disease-causing proteins. These molecules, functioning as “molecular bridges,” hyperlink a goal protein to the mobile equipment answerable for protein degradation. This bridging mechanism permits for the focused removing of proteins beforehand thought-about “undruggable” by conventional strategies that sometimes inhibit protein perform fairly than get rid of the protein itself. For instance, a bivalent molecule may be designed with one arm that binds to a selected protein focused for degradation, and one other arm that recruits an E3 ubiquitin ligase, a key part of the protein degradation system.

The flexibility to selectively get rid of proteins opens thrilling new avenues for therapeutic intervention. This method provides potential benefits over conventional drug modalities by addressing the basis explanation for illnesses pushed by problematic proteins, fairly than simply mitigating their results. Traditionally, drug growth has targeted on inhibiting the perform of disease-related proteins. Nonetheless, many proteins lack appropriate binding websites for efficient inhibition. This new degradation expertise overcomes this limitation, vastly increasing the vary of probably druggable targets and providing new hope for illnesses at the moment missing efficient therapies.
